The surname Botelo has diverse origins, with variations in spelling and meaning depending on the region it is found in. One of the possible origins of the name Botelo is Spanish, where it is believed to have originated from the word “Bote,” meaning barrel or cask. This suggests that the surname Botelo may have been used to describe a barrel maker or a merchant involved in the trade of barrels.
Another possible origin of the surname Botelo is Portuguese, where it is believed to have originated from the word “Botelho,” a topographic surname meaning someone who lived near a clump of bushes or trees. This suggests that the surname Botelo may have been used to describe someone who lived in a wooded area or near a tree cluster.

The surname Botelo has a notable presence in the United States, with an incidence rate of 24. This suggests that there are a significant number of individuals with the surname Botelo living in the United States, particularly in regions with a strong Spanish or Portuguese heritage.
In Argentina, the surname Botelo has an incidence rate of 16, indicating a moderate presence of individuals with the surname Botelo in the country. This suggests that the name Botelo may have been brought to Argentina by Spanish or Portuguese immigrants, contributing to the cultural diversity of the nation.
With an incidence rate of 10, the surname Botelo has a noticeable presence in the Philippines. This suggests that the name Botelo may have been introduced to the Philippines through colonial influences or trade connections, adding to the multicultural fabric of the country.
In India, the surname Botelo has an incidence rate of 9, indicating a modest presence of individuals with the surname Botelo in the country. This suggests that the name Botelo may have been adopted by Indian families through intercultural relationships or migrations, highlighting the diverse nature of the Indian population.
With an incidence rate of 7, the surname Botelo has a minor presence in Brazil. This suggests that the name Botelo may have been brought to Brazil by Portuguese settlers or immigrants, contributing to the multicultural heritage of the nation.
Botelo is also found in a variety of other countries, with varying incidence rates. These include Mexico (3), Venezuela (3), Colombia (2), Guatemala (2), Peru (2), Bolivia (1), Switzerland (1), Cuba (1), Togo (1), Uruguay (1), and South Africa (1).
